一条语句删除集合中的全部记录
发布于 5 年前 作者 ryin 4239 次浏览 来自 分享

我之前一直是通过删除集合的这种方式来删除集合中的数据的,昨天的小程序云开发直播课程中学到了一招,代码如下

1

db.collection('test').where({
_id: _.exists(true)
}).remove()

2

希望教给大家,截图如下所示

3

具体官方API文档如下

https://developers.weixin.qq.com/miniprogram/dev/wxcloud/reference-sdk-api/database/command/Command.exists.html

下面两张图跟本文无关,但是没有地方放了,放这里留存下

1

2

以上截图出自下面文章

http://i.hackweek.org/tcb/1201.html

如果大家有其他更好的方式,也可以在评论去留言,谢谢。

2 回复
db.collection('test').where({
  }).remove()
貌似也可以?

回复楼上

回到顶部